Wyoming Theater Arts is the student-driven, extracurricular drama program of Wyoming High School.  Our goal is to foster enrichment in theatre arts through hands-on education.  Students have the opportunity to participate in all aspects of theater and musical theater production:

Acting techniques, script and role interpretation, and individual presentation
Technical skills which include set building and design, light and sound design, costuming, publicity, stage and house management
Vocal, instrumental, and dance skills specific to music theater
Our students work hard to create exceptional productions.  Two full length plays and one musical are presented each year.  Our program achieves success assisting a number of students  prepare for participation in college and university theater programs, as well as professionally.

Any high school student is welcome-no previous experience is necessary, and every person’s energy and contribution counts.  Camaraderie is cultivated and friendships are created and nurtured in a safe environment.  Participation in WTAD will also promote development of integrative life skills such as analytical and creative thought processing, team building, personal responsibility and pride in exceptional work-skills that carry over into life after graduation and assist students in their journey toward becoming productive, self-confident individuals.
